Johannes Häggqvist 8e69f36f04 Add WireMockHealthCheck in WireMock.Net.Aspire (#1375)
* Add WireMockHealthCheck

For use with Aspire, to make WaitFor(wiremock) more useful.
Calls /__admin/health and checks the result, as well as checks if mappings using AdminApiMappingBuilder has been submitted to the server.

This created a catch-22 problem where the mappings were not submitted until the health check was healthy, but the health check was not healthy until the mappings were submitted.

To avoid this, the WireMockServerLifecycleHook class has been slightly re-arranged, and is now using the AfterEndpointsAllocatedAsync callback rather than the AfterResourcesCreatedAsync callback. Within which a separate Task is created that waits until the server is ready and submits the mappings.

* Move WireMockMappingState to its own file

* Dispose the cancellation tokens in WireMockServerLifecycleHook

Dom Light 70a9180af4 Set description when converting MappingModel to IRespondWithAProvider (#1317)
Adding a mapping with a description to `WireMockServer.WithMapping`
did not include the description to the resulting
`IRespondWithAProvider`, which means that calling
`WireMockServer.SavePact` does not populate the description in the
contract file.

This PR includes the description when mapping from `MappingModel` to
`IRespondWithAProvider`.

Sébastien Crocquesel 8ba243ddcd Bump Testcontainers version to 4.5.0 (#1311)
* Bump Testcontainers version to 4.5.0

The Testcontainers dependency Docker.DotNet was bumped to 3.128.1 and is not binary compatible with previous version.
When a user has a direct dependency on Testcontainers 4.5.0, WireMock.Net.Testcontainers fails with :

System.MissingMethodException : Method not found: 'Docker.DotNet.DockerClient Docker.DotNet.DockerClientConfiguration.CreateClient(System.Version)'

* Bump System.Net.Http.Json version to 8.0.1

Minimum required version for Testcontainers 4.5.0

* Do not dispose null container
